Let's break down the problem step-by-step to find out how much more Bernard will pay for life insurance annually due to his health issues.

1. Determine the annual premium for a male of age 35 without health issues:
- The insurance amount is [tex]\( \$115,000 \)[/tex].
- The annual insurance premium per [tex]\( \$1,000 \)[/tex] of face value for a 10-year term policy at age 35 (for males) is [tex]\( \$1.40 \)[/tex].

First we need to calculate the total annual premium for a male without health issues:

[tex]\[ \text{Annual premium without health issues} = \left( \frac{\$115,000}{\$1,000} \right) \times \$1.40 \][/tex]

Simplifying this:

[tex]\[ \text{Annual premium without health issues} = 115 \times 1.40 = \$161.00 \][/tex]

2. Calculate how much more Bernard will pay due to his health issues:
- Bernard has health issues which increase his premium by [tex]\( 15\% \)[/tex].

To find the additional amount that Bernard has to pay, we need 15% of the annual premium calculated above:

[tex]\[ \text{Additional due to health issues} = \$161.00 \times 0.15 \][/tex]

Simplifying this:

[tex]\[ \text{Additional due to health issues} = \$24.15 \][/tex]

So, Bernard has to pay [tex]\( \$24.15 \)[/tex] more annually because of his health issues.
